

Tanglin Trust School and United World College Southeast Asia (UWCSEA) are two of Singapore's most established international schools, with combined operational histories in Southeast Asia spanning over 150 years. The central difference between them lies in upper secondary curriculum structure and institutional mission: Tanglin Trust offers a dual-pathway Sixth Form where students choose between A-Levels or the IB Diploma on a single campus in Portsdown, whereas UWCSEA delivers a concept-based IB continuum across two campuses anchored in service learning, global peace, and outdoor education.
Tanglin Trust School vs United World College Southeast Asia at a Glance
Factor | Tanglin Trust School | UWCSEA (Dover & East) |
Secondary Qualification | Dual Pathway: Choice of A-Levels OR IB Diploma | Full IB Continuum: K–10 Concept → FIB/IGCSE → IBDP |
Founded in Singapore | 1925 (100+ years of history) | 1971 (Dover) / 2008 (East) |
Campuses | 1 Campus (Portsdown Road / One-North) | 2 Campuses (Dover in West / East in Tampines) |
Age Range / Grades | Ages 3–18 (Nursery to Sixth Form) | Ages 4–18 (K1 to Grade 12) |
Total Enrolment | ~2,800 students | ~5,800+ students across both campuses |
Annual Tuition (2026/2027) | S$36,300 (K1) – S$58,080 (Sixth Form) | S$39,069 (Kindergarten) – S$48,237 (High School) |
Mandatory Levies | S$4,500 Enrolment Fee + S$4,500 Capital Levy | S$9,537 Yr 1 Development Levy (S$4,986 subsequent) |
Academic Results (Recent) | IB Diploma Average: 39.1 | A-Levels: 63% A*/A grades | IB Diploma Average: 36.3 across 640+ candidates in 2026 |
Core Ethos | British educational excellence, custom Sixth Form options | Service learning, global citizenship, environmental action |
Curriculum Differences Between Tanglin Trust School and United World College
What Tanglin Trust School Offers: Academic choice in Sixth Form (Years 12–13) where students select either A-Levels (3–4 specialised subjects) or the IB Diploma. Outstanding academic results: 39.1 IB average and 63% A*/A grades in A-Levels.
Verdict: Ideal for families who want qualification choice between specialised study (A-Levels) and multi-disciplinary study (IB) at age 16.What United World College Southeast Asia Offers: Unified IB learning continuum structured around five pillars (Academics, Activities, Outdoor Education, Personal/Social Education, Service). All students complete the IB Diploma or IB Courses in Grades 11–12. Class of 2026's IB cohort of 642 students had a pass rate of 98.9%. The world average pass rate was 82.6%.
Verdict: Ideal for families seeking an inquiry-led IB education deeply integrated with community service and environmental action.
Campus, Facilities & Community
Tanglin Trust: Single-site campus on Portsdown Road housing Infant, Junior, and Senior schools, featuring the Centenary Building and an Olympic-caliber pool.
UWCSEA: Dual mega-campus setup—Dover (West) and East (Tampines)—serving over 5,800 students across 100+ nationalities.
Fees & Financial Planning
Tanglin Trust Fee Profile: Sixth Form tuition is S$58,080 per year. One-time entry fees total S$10,000.
UWCSEA Fee Profile: High school tuition is S$48,237 per year, plus an annual Development Levy (S$9,537 year one, S$4,986 subsequent).

Frequently Asked Questions About Tanglin Trust School and United World College
Does United World College Southeast Asia offer A-Levels?
No, United World College Southeast Asia offers the IB Diploma Programme and IB Courses.
Can a student switch from IB to A-Levels at Tanglin Trust School later?
Pathway selections are finalised in Year 11; switching mid-course in Year 12 is restricted.
Are Tanglin Trust School's pathways on the same campus?
Yes, both A-Level and IB students share the Senior School campus on Portsdown Road.
Which school has better university outcomes?
Both achieve top global placement into Oxford, Cambridge, Ivy League, and Russell Group universities.
Is United World College Southeast Asia Dover or East better?
Both campuses follow the same academic curriculum, fee structure, and learning philosophy from K1 through Grade 12.
